| Class | Vehicles | DVSA max | Typical |
|---|---|---|---|
| Class 1 | Motorcycles up to 200cc | £29.65 | £20-29 |
| Class 2 | Motorcycles over 200cc | £29.65 | £20-29 |
| Class 3 | Three-wheeled vehicles up to 450kg | £37.80 | £28-37 |
| Class 4 | Cars, light vans up to 3,000kg, motor caravans, taxis, minibuses up to 12 seats | £54.85 | £30-45 |
| Class 5 | Private passenger vehicles with 13 or more seats | £59.55 to £80.65 | £50-80 |
| Class 7 | Goods vehicles 3,000 to 3,500kg | £58.60 | £40-55 |
Caps are the DVSA statutory maximums (unchanged since April 2010, re-verified 24 August 2026); typical charges are this site's observed ranges. The MOT fee is VAT-exempt. Edinburgh and Glasgow are competitive; remote Highland garages tend to be pricier. See the full fee guide and how to pay less.
